The Meeting Do Board Format Minutes in Bexar is a legal document designed to record important details of board meetings or the waiver of such meetings. This form is crucial for maintaining transparency and accountability within an organization’s governance. Key features include sections for specifying the corporation's name, the names and signatures of the directors, and the date of the waiver. Users are instructed to fill in the corporation's name and ensure all directors sign the document to validate the waiver. The format for a meeting depends on the meeting type and style. While there is no set format for meeting minutes, templates provide guidelines for essential information that should be included in your documentation.

What Should Be Included in Meeting Minutes? Date and time of the meeting. Names of the meeting participants and those unable to attend (e.g., “regrets”) Acceptance or corrections/amendments to previous meeting minutes. Decisions made about each agenda item, for example: Actions taken or agreed to be taken. Next steps.

There are three standard styles of minutes: action, discussion, and verbatim. Each style has a specific use.

What information do board meeting minutes contain? Meeting date, time and location. Type of meeting. Names and titles of attendees and guests. Any absent board directors. Quorum. Notes about directors who left early or re-entered the meeting. Board approvals, resolutions and acceptance of reports. Overview of discussions.

The format of the minutes should closely follow the format of the agenda. It's easier to record the minutes if the meeting follows the agenda. The minutes are generally taken down at the meeting in a rough format then later written or typed properly and fully, unless the meeting has been recorded.
